Day 3 - Tue: Dublin City Tour
This morning your guide will introduce you to the many different parts of central Dublin. Pass historic buildings, Georgian streets with elegant town houses, public parks and monuments. Stop for a guided tour around the State Apartments of Dublin Castle where many historic events have taken place. Visit Kilmainham Gaol which retells the story of Ireland's fight for freedom and see how penal establishments operated over the centuries. The afternoon and evening are free for independent activities. (B)

Day 4 - Wed: National Stud & Kilkenny
In Kildare visit the Irish National Stud to learn about Irish horses, breeding programs and their status in worldwide racing circles. Also visit the charming Japanese Gardens, designed in classical Asian style to represent the "Life of Man." Arrive in Kilkenny around midday to check into your hotel, located in the center of this fascinating town. Take a walking tour with a local guide around the old sections where the narrow streets follow medieval patterns. See Killkenny's ancient houses and churches as your learn about the history. Enjoy some free time after the tour. (B, D)

Day 5 - Thu: Waterford & Cobh Heritage Centre
Drive to Waterford to tour the famous Waterford Crystal Factory and watch skilled craftspeople creating elegant masterpieces. In the showrooms see a huge collection of tableware and trophies. Outside Cork visit the Cobh Heritage Centre to learn about emigration from Ireland and Europe during the last two centuries. Enjoy some free time in Cobh before driving through Cork to Clonakilty to meet your host family for your farmhouse stay. After a home-style dinner, go out for some lively local entertainment. (B, D)

Day 6 - Fri: Bantry House & Glengarriff
Leave your host families and drive west through Skibbereen to Bantry House. Visit this elegant Georgian mansion which was built in 1740 for the Earls of Bantry and contains furnishings gathered from many European countries. Travel to Glengarriff, which is renowned for its sub-tropical plants which flourish in the sheltered bays. Cross the Caha Mountains, pass through Kenmare and drive along part of the Ring of Kerry route via Moll's Gap for views of Killarney's famous lakes nestled at the foot of the mountains. (B, D)

Day 7 - Sat: Dingle Peninsula Tour
Today travel along the Dingle Peninsula where you will relish stunning views of the Slieve Mish Mountains, the shoreline of Dingle Bay and the open Atlantic Ocean. Stop in Dingle, a thriving fishing town, before heading to the tip of the peninsula to see the Blasket Islands offshore. Stop to visit Louis Mulcahy Pottery to see potters creating this attractive tableware. Visit Gallarus Oratory, a tiny 6th century church which was built of unmortared stone. Return to Tralee and back to Killarney in time to relax before dinner. Afterwards head to the Laurels, one of Killarney's lively 'singing pubs.' (B, D)

Day 8 - Sun: Cliffs of Moher & Galway
Drive north from Killarney to Listowel for a brief stroll around this attractive town, noted for its associations with many local playwrights, including J.B. Keane. From Tarbert take a ferry across the River Shannon to visit the Cliffs of Moher, majestic walls of rock which extend five miles along the coast. Drive through the Burren Country, a region of rounded limestone hills, and around Galway Bay into the town of Galway. Check into your hotel which is located overlooking Galway Bay. (B, D)

Day 9 - Mon: "The Quiet Man" Tour & Connemara
Drive north from Galway via Headford to Cong, a delightful village made famous by the 1952 movie of "The Quiet Man." A walking tour around the village will reveal places featured in the movie. Then travel through Connemara, a region of heathery hills and bogland where sheep roam freely. See where local people harvest peat for domestic heating. Drive through Maam Cross and stop to see the Connemara Celtic Crystal Factory for a demonstration of the craft of cutting intricate designs into colored crystal. Return to Galway. (B, D)
